How Insulation Plays a Vital Role in Winter Garments

Although many individuals emphasize style when selecting winter apparel, insulation performs an essential role in maintaining warmth and comfort. Insulation functions as a barrier against extreme cold, trapping body heat and stopping it from escaping. Quality insulation materials, such as down feathers and synthetic fibers, help regulate temperature, seeing to it that the wearer remains warm amid icy conditions.

The quality and thickness of insulation directly impact the garment's warmth. Thicker layers typically offer better protection, however lightweight options can deliver sufficient warmth without bulk. Additionally, proper insulation improves breathability, enabling moisture to escape while retaining heat.

During cold seasons, investing in well-insulated clothing is imperative for outdoor activities, as inadequate insulation can lead to discomfort and health risks such as hypothermia. Thus, understanding the importance of insulation is vital for anyone wanting to stay warm and comfortable during the winter months.

Choosing the Correct Fabrics for Frigid Weather

In selecting winter clothing, understanding the right fabrics is essential for enhancing warmth and comfort. Natural materials such as wool and down are renowned for their excellent insulation properties. Wool is particularly proficient at regulating body temperature and wicking moisture away from the skin, keeping users dry and warm. Down, obtained from the soft feathers of ducks or geese, delivers a lightweight yet highly powerful insulation solution, ideal for jackets and coats.

Artificial textiles, like polyester and nylon, play a crucial role in winter apparel. These materials are frequently resistant to water and fast-drying, making them well-suited for outer layers facing the elements. Additionally, fleece provides a soft, insulating layer that maintains heat without adding bulk. When picking winter clothing, it is vital to consider the balance of warmth, moisture management, and weather resistance that different fabrics provide, maintaining comfort during cold weather conditions.

Adaptable Layering Strategy Techniques for Maximum Insulation

Layering is a practical approach to winter clothing that maximizes warmth and adaptability in varying temperatures. The cornerstone of proper layering commences with a base layer that wicks moisture. This layer, often made from synthetic fibers or merino wool, helps to keep the skin dry by drawing sweat away.

Next, a thermal insulating layer, including fleece or down, preserves body heat without adding bulk. This layer can be adjusted based on activity levels; for example, one may choose a lighter fleece during milder days or a thicker down jacket during extreme cold.

Finally, an outer layer, such as a thick coat, provides additional insulation. This outer layer can also hold additional mid-layers, permitting for rapid adjustments. By carefully blending these elements, individuals can create flexible outfits that guarantee maximum warmth, comfort, and flexibility throughout winter's changeable weather.

Understanding Waterproof and Windproof Materials

As winter weather can bring unpredictable elements, the value of waterproof and windproof materials in winter clothing cannot be overstated. These materials serve as barriers against moisture and fierce winds, guaranteeing that individuals remain dry and warm in harsh conditions. Waterproof fabrics, often coated with durable water repellent (DWR) coatings, stop moisture penetration, while windproof materials stop cold air from reaching the skin.

This pairing is essential for preserving comfort and body heat during outdoor activities. As an illustration, a windproof jacket paired with waterproof pants creates an effective shield against the elements, strengthening overall protection. Moreover, state-of-the-art developments in material science have led to the development of breathable waterproof fabrics, which allow moisture from sweat to escape while keeping external water out. This balance of protection and breathability is essential for those taking part in winter sports or daily commutes, making quality winter clothing indispensable for anyone facing the season's challenges.
